Analysis
Zimbabwe recorded -0.0799 % change on previous year for milk production, annual growth rate in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 102.7% on the previous year and down 103.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, milk production, annual growth rate in Zimbabwe peaked at 33.25 % change on previous year in 1998 and was at its lowest, -18.39 % change on previous year, in 2002.
Zimbabwe ranks 135th of 192 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Milk production.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Milk production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(2025) – with major processing by Our World in Data
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
